Safety seminars cancelled due to COVID-19 impacts

We’d like to inform industry about changes to upcoming events due to the impacts of COVID-19.

The 2nd Mining Engineering Managers Safety Seminar, which was scheduled for 13 and 14 October 2021, has been cancelled. 

The Mechanical Engineering Safety Seminar, which was scheduled for 26 and 27 October 2021, has also been cancelled. We will inform industry of rescheduled dates

The Electrical Engineering Safety Seminar is currently under review. It is currently scheduled for 10 and 11 November 2021 but may need to be rescheduled due to the impacts of COVID-19.

We will keep industry updated regarding any changes to the dates of these events and other Regulator activities. Please visit our event calendar for up-to-date information.
